City Council Meeting
Tuesday, June 23 2020, 6 p.m.

Due to recommended social distancing measures to stop the spread of coronavirus and the City Manager’s Emergency Order suspending the provisions of UCO § 2.20.075 regarding council member participation by teleconference, this meeting will be conducted via telephone conference call, though a limited number of Council Members may be in Chambers while observing six foot social distancing.

Starting June 23, we will allow a limited number of community members to attend the meeting in person. In order to provide for social distancing, we can accommodate five people in chambers, who will be seated on a first come/first served basis. Coverings over nose and mouth are required to be worn upon entering the building and until seated; and again when exiting chambers and the building.

Members of the public can listen to the meeting on KUCB TV Channel 8 or Radio station 89.7.

Options to provide comments or testimony to City Council regarding items on the agenda:

· Email comments, testimony or questions to the City Clerk no later than 5:00 p.m. on the day of the meeting. Comments, testimony and questions will be read by the clerk during the meeting
